Commander R.N.R. William John Enright, (11 April, 1888 – ) served in the Royal Naval Reserve.

Life & Career

Enright was promoted to the rank of Lieutenant R.N.R. on 2 August, 1915.[1]

Enright was promoted to the rank of Lieutenant-Commander R.N.R. on 2 August, 1923.[2]

Enright was promoted to the rank of Commander R.N.R. on 30 June, 1930.[3]
